A growing number of individuals are claiming disability benefits through the Access to Work scheme, sparked by social media 'sickfluencers' who share their experiences with ADHD and other mental health conditions. This scheme provides eligible individuals with free items and services, including noise-cancelling headphones, Apple smartwatches, and work coaches, to help them manage their conditions. With benefits of up to £69,000 per year, the scheme has become a vital support system for those struggling with mental health issues, including anxiety and depression. However, concerns have been raised about the impact of self-diagnosis on the system. Mental health awareness and support are crucial in addressing this issue.
